The 2026 Adobe Summit served as a symbolic hand‑off for Shantanu Narayen, who confirmed his exit while reaffirming the company’s commitment to an AI‑first roadmap. Analysts see the leadership change as a test of Adobe’s ability to sustain momentum without its long‑time chief, especially as the firm battles rivals in generative‑AI and cloud‑based creative suites. By keeping the strategic vision publicly anchored, Adobe aims to reassure investors that product pipelines and revenue growth will remain on track.

At the core of Adobe’s narrative is the convergence of creativity and productivity through generative AI. Tools such as Firefly, Photoshop, Illustrator and Premiere Pro now embed large‑language‑model capabilities, offering semantic editing, mood‑board creation and AI‑driven production studios. Narayen stressed that every new surface—whether Microsoft Copilot, ChatGPT or emerging LLMs—represents an additional channel for content creation and consumption. This multi‑surface approach expands the addressable market beyond traditional designers to marketers, sales teams and everyday consumers, reinforcing Adobe’s claim as the world’s largest provider of marketing technology.

For enterprise customers, the conversation has shifted from AI transformation to measurable AI execution. Adobe is positioning its Customer Experience Management and orchestration platform as the hub that unifies data, workflows and AI‑generated assets across brands. By offering enterprise‑grade models that respect organizational data and by integrating conversational agents, Adobe helps firms accelerate time‑to‑value while reducing adoption anxiety. This focus on orchestration and AI‑enabled customization is expected to deepen Adobe’s penetration in high‑margin B2B segments, driving sustainable revenue growth beyond its consumer‑centric legacy.
